“K-Pop Demon Hunters” has become a global crowd-puller ever since its release on “Netflix,” on June 20, 2025. This movie is an empowering musical with action-packed battles, along with a hidden romance. Rumi, Mira, and Zoey present themselves as a K-pop group named “Huntrix,” but, they’re saving the world with their motivational songs and combating by sealing what’s called “The Honmoon,” dividing the world from an opposite universe of demons.
As the Honmoon is close to being sealed, five intelligent demons come up with an idea to start a K-pop boy band to recruit more souls. People know them as the “Saja Boys,” the new K-pop group that is all the rage. Huntix and Saja Boys advance in continuous battles to seal and break The Honmoon.

Not only is “K-pop Demon Hunters” an action-packed movie, but it also has a musical soundtrack with actual K-pop that is empowering and has been favored by many. The songs in this movie include their own songs, along with sampled songs and artists that have helped out. The soundtrack includes: “How It’s Done,” “Soda Pop,” “Golden,” “Takedown,” “Your Idol,” “Free,” “What It Sounds Like,” along with “Love, Maybe” by MeloMance. The K-pop girl group, TWICE, had assisted with the movie by letting them sample their famous hit, “Strategy.”
“K-pop Demon Hunters” also resembles certain parts in K-pop. They took lightsticks, music, and group concepts into creative work. People all over the world have noticed that Huntrix resembles girl-empowering groups, such as Blackpink, ITZY, and TWICE. The directors chose a more dark, yet enlightening concept for the Saja Boys, favoring BTS, TOMORROW X TOGETHER, Stray Kids, and ATEEZ. Citizens really appreciated mixing the concepts of many favorites and popular groups, especially ATEEZ and TOMORROW X TOGETHER, by combining ATEEZ’s new dark concept from their new album, “In Your Fantasy” and TOMORROW X TOGETHER’s ethereal and upbeat concept.
